Transaction eb28035b5232ede7c77836187c3d5527b34955718a977e9711a21f4110c0e589
1 Input
1 Output
-
eb28035b5232ede7c77836187c3d5527b34955718a977e9711a21f4110c0e589:0
- value
- 2663187
- script pubkey
- OP_0 OP_PUSHBYTES_20 b17958855122c48e10bc2c1821355fab7bbfce76
- address
- bc1qk9u43p23ytzguy9u9svzzd2l4damlnnkml4g9m